/SQLR/SQLRSUM is a standard SAP Structure so does not store data like a database table does. It can be used to define the fields of other actual tables or to process "Summary data of SQLR (Summary download for SQLR)" Information within sap ABAP programs.

This is done by declaring abap internal tables, work areas or database tables based on this Structure. These can then be used to store and process the required data appropriately.

i.e. DATA: wa_/SQLR/SQLRSUM TYPE /SQLR/SQLRSUM.

How do I retrieve data from SAP structure /SQLR/SQLRSUM using ABAP code?

As /SQLR/SQLRSUM is a database structure and not a table it does not store any data in the SAP data dictionary. The ABAP SELECT statement is therefore not appropriate and can not be performed on /SQLR/SQLRSUM as there is no data to select.
